HomeMy WebLinkAboutRESOLUTION - 63-83 - 9/27/1983 - AMEND DEFERRED COMPENSATION PLAN RESOLUTION NO. 63-83 A RESOLUTION AMENDING THE VILLAGE OF ELK GROVE VILLAGE 'S DEFERRED COMPENSATION PLAN SPONSORED THROUGH THE INTERNATIONAL CITY MANAGE- MENT ASSOCIATION RETIREMENT CORPORATION WHEREAS, the Employer maintains a deferred compensation plan for its employees which is administered by the ICMA Retirement Corporation (the "Administrator") ; and WHEREAS, the Administrator has recommended changes in the plan document to comply with recent federal legislation and Internal Revenue Service Regulations governing said plans; and WHEREAS, the Internal Revenue Service has issued a private letter ruling approving said plan document as complying with Section 457 of the Internal Revenue Code; and WHEREAS, other public employers have joined together to establish the ICMA Retirement Trust for the purpose of representing the interest of the participating employers with respect to the collective investment of funds held under their deferred plans; and WHEREAS, said Trust is a salutary development which further advances the quality of administration for plans administered by the ICMA Retirement Corporation: N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the Employer hereby adopts the deferred compensation plan, attached hereto as Appendix A, as an amendment and restatement of its present deferred compensation plan; and B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Employer hereby executes the ICMA Retirement Trust, attached hereto as Appendix B; and B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Employer hereby adopts the trust agreement with the ICMA Retirement Corporation, as appears at Appendix C hereto, as an amendment and restatement of its existing trust agreement with the ICMA Retirement Corporation , and directs the ICMA Retirement Corporation, as Trustee, to invest all funds held under the deferred compensation plan throught the ICMA Retirement Trust as soon as it practicable; and BE IT FURTHER RES OLV ED that the V i I I age Manager sha I I be the coo rdi na to r for this program and shall receive necessary reports, notices, etc. from the [CMA Retirement Corporation as Administrator, and shall cast, on behalf of the Employer, any required votes under the 'pro�_!rafn. Administrative duties to carry out the plan may be assigned to the appropriate departments. PASSED this 27-th day of Septenber 1983. APPROVED this 27th day of Septeniber 1983.
